**Finance Review — Southmere Expansion**

Board summary: the push into the Southmere region is tracking ahead of plan. Setup costs came in under budget, and early bookings beat the model by about 15%. Local hiring is the main drag. Darl's team recommends accelerating phase two, and the proposed approach is laid out below.

board note of yawep-fahif: Gross margin on Wenath came in at 15 percent against a plan of 5 percent. Only 9 of the 140 pilot accounts renewed Wenath, so a churn review is set for April 15.

## Tuning

The Haverlode fuel report aggregates telemetry per vehicle per shift. Defaults suit fleets under 500 units; larger fleets should widen the aggregation window and raise the batch size. Outlier trimming is aggressive by default — loosen it if depot idling skews totals. Recompute runs nightly. Current defaults for the weekly run are listed below.

tuning table, yajog-yahof:
BUDGETS = {
    "lamvan": 303,
    "wenox": 460,
    "fenvan": 525,
}

// REINDEX_BATCH_CAP limits docs per shard pass in the Tallowfield
// nightly search reindex. Raising it starves the ingest queue;
// lowering it overruns the maintenance window. 5000 is the tested
// sweet spot. Change only with a soak run. Verified against the
// build noted below.

session token of bawif-hahog = htk6_ac5981